Hoppa till innehåll

How AR Image Recognition Uses AI and ML

ai based image recognition

Training image recognition systems can be performed in one of three ways — supervised learning, unsupervised learning or self-supervised learning. Usually, the labeling of the training data is the main distinction between the three training approaches. Additionally, real-time visual data analysis gives business owners insightful information that enables them to act quickly on information gleaned through image recognition technologies. This can be done by using some crucial insights about consumer behaviour that image recognition systems can provide.

ai based image recognition

Modern algorithms are utilized for access control devices like smartphone locks and private property entrances since they can accurately recognize people by face. The automated fault detection procedure used in manufacturing is a key example of object detection in action. For instance, Utility businesses can get automated asset management services from Hepta. Drones are used by their product to easily take pictures of electrical wires. They use a sliding detection window technique by moving around the image. The algorithm then takes the test picture and compares the trained histogram values with the ones of various parts of the picture to check for close matches.

The Process of Image Recognition System

AR image recognition can also encounter technical and operational difficulties, such as compatibility, scalability, and reliability of the hardware and software. Moreover, AR image recognition can require high computational power and bandwidth, which can affect the performance and battery life of the devices. Improvements made in the field of AI and picture recognition for the past decades have been tremendous. There is absolutely no doubt that researchers are already looking for new techniques based on all the possibilities provided by these exceptional technologies.

Philippine regulators told to empower users, workers to tackle AI threats – BusinessWorld Online

Philippine regulators told to empower users, workers to tackle AI threats.

Posted: Sun, 11 Jun 2023 16:31:32 GMT [source]

Before installing a CNN algorithm, you should get some more details about the complex architecture of this particular model, and the way it works. Nowadays Computer Vision and Artificial Intelligence have become very important industries. It is known to use very efficient tools metadialog.com and to be able to give an answer to a lot of different issues. Image Recognition is beginning to have a key position in today’s society. Many companies’ CEOs truly believe it represents the future of their activities, and have already started applying it to their system.

AI-based Image Recognition

The service is based on Jupyter Notebooks, allowing AI developers to share their knowledge and expertise in a comfortable way. Plus, in contrast to similar services, Colab provides free GPU resources. The pooling operation involves sliding a two-dimensional filter over each channel of the feature map and summarising the features lying within the region covered by the filter.

ai based image recognition

However, this approach is not sufficient to determine the eligibility of a student for an examination as these means of identification can easily be falsified. This paper therefore, develops a face recognition web service model for student identity verification using Deep Neural Network (DNN) and Support Vector Machine (SVM). Oracle offers a Free Tier with no time limits on more than 20 services such as Autonomous Database, Arm Compute, and Storage, as well as US$300 in free credits to try additional cloud services. Imagga Technologies is a pioneer and a global innovator in the image recognition as a service space. Imagga’s Auto-tagging API is used to automatically tag all photos from the Unsplash website. Providing relevant tags for the photo content is one of the most important and challenging tasks for every photography site offering huge amount of image content.

Fraud and counterfeit detection and protection

This can lead to increased processing time and computational requirements. Image classification, on the other hand, focuses solely on assigning images to categories, making it a simpler and often faster process. Image recognition based on AI techniques can be a rather nerve-wracking task with all the errors you might encounter while coding. In this article, we are going to look at two simple use cases of image recognition with one of the frameworks of deep learning. The classification method (also called supervised learning) uses a machine-learning algorithm to estimate a feature in the image called an important characteristic. It then uses this feature to make a prediction about whether an image is likely to be of interest to a given user.

Which AI algorithm is best for image recognition?

Due to their unique work principle, convolutional neural networks (CNN) yield the best results with deep learning image recognition.

Vivino is very intuitive and has easy navigation, ensuring you can get all the necessary information after taking a shot of a wine bottle you want to buy yet while at a liquor store. Because Visual AI can process batches of millions of images at a time, it is a powerful new tool in the fight against copyright infringement and counterfeiting. Up until 2012, the winners of the competition usually won with an error rate that hovered around 25% – 30%.

Use cases of image recognition

Cloud Vision allows you to use pre-trained machine learning models and create and train custom models for creating image processing projects using machine learning. Machines can be taught to interpret images the same way our brains do and to analyze those images much more thoroughly than we can. Before starting with this blog, first have a basic introduction to CNN to brush up on your skills. The visual performance of Humans is much better than that of computers, probably because of superior high-level image understanding, contextual knowledge, and massively parallel processing.

  • Python Artificial Intelligence (AI) can be used in a variety of applications, such as facial recognition, object detection, and medical imaging.
  • Medical imaging is a popular field where both image recognition and classification have significant applications.
  • Image recognition uses technology and techniques to help computers identify, label, and classify elements of interest in an image.
  • Some companies have developed their own AI algorithm for their specific activities.
  • It is also possible to detect the edges of various objects in an image by analyzing these contrasts and gradients.
  • The intention was to work with a small group of MIT students during the summer months to tackle the challenges and problems that the image recognition domain was facing.

It allows computers to understand and describe the content of images in a more human-like way. Facial recognition is the use of AI algorithms to identify a person from a digital image or video stream. AI allows facial recognition systems to map the features of a face image and compares them to a face database. The comparison is usually done by calculating a similarity score between the extracted features and the features of the known faces in the database.

Image Recognition vs. Computer Vision

Tailored for grocery retail, Vispera’s IR-based products meet the needs of the industry with specific customer needs and use cases. There are two products designed by Vispera, “Storesense” and “Shelfsight”. While Storesense is a mobile image collection system, Shelfsight is an in-store fixed camera system. An image, for a computer, is just a bunch of pixels – either as a vector image or raster. In raster images, each pixel is arranged in a grid form, while in a vector image, they are arranged as polygons of different colors.

  • Image recognition (or image classification) is the task of identifying images and categorizing them in one of several predefined distinct classes.
  • However, as each of these phases requires processing massive amounts of data, you can’t do it manually.
  • That way, the picture is divided into different feature plans and is treated separately, and the machine is able to handle the analysis of more objects.
  • By then, the limit of computer storage was no longer holding back the development of machine learning algorithms.
  • Convolutional neural networks consist of several layers with small neuron collections, each of them perceiving small parts of an image.
  • Video classification is an important task for archiving digital contents for various video service providers.

Perhaps even more impactful is the new avenues which adopting these new methods can open for entire R&D processes. Engineers need fewer testing iterations to converge to an optimum solution, and prototyping can be dramatically reduced. This is particularly true for 3D data which can contain non-parametric elements of aesthetics/ergonomics and can therefore be difficult to structure for a data analysis exercise. Researching this possibility has been our focus for the last few years, and we have today built numerous AI tools capable of considerably accelerating engineering design cycles. This data is based on ineradicable governing physical laws and relationships. Unlike financial data, for example, data generated by engineers reflect an underlying truth – that of physics, as first described by Newton, Bernoulli, Fourier or Laplace.

The State of Facial Recognition Today

Without the help of image recognition technology, a computer vision model cannot detect, identify and perform image classification. Therefore, an AI-based image recognition software should be capable of decoding images and be able to do predictive analysis. To this end, AI models are trained on massive datasets to bring about accurate predictions. Image recognition is a key feature of augmented reality (AR) applications that can enhance security and authentication in various domains. AR image recognition uses artificial intelligence (AI) and machine learning (ML) to analyze and identify objects, faces, and scenes in real time.

Can AI analyze a picture?

OpenText™ AI Image Analytics gives you access to real-time, highly accurate image analytics for uses from traffic optimization to physical security.

You can consider checking out Google’s Colab Python Online Compiler as well. These standards are removed from active status through an administrative process for standards that have not undergone a revision process within 10 years. A not-for-profit organization, IEEE is the world’s largest technical professional organization dedicated to advancing technology for the benefit of humanity.© Copyright 2023 IEEE – All rights reserved. Use of this web site signifies your agreement to the terms and conditions.

Other common types of image recognition

In supervised learning, a process is used to determine if a particular image is in a certain category, and then it is compared with the ones in the category that have already been detected. In unsupervised learning, a process is used to determine if an image is in a category by itself. Neural networks are complex computational methods designed to allow for classification and tracking of images. In layman’s terms, a convolutional neural network is a network that uses a series of filters to identify the data held within an image. This all changed as computer hardware rapidly evolved from the late eighties onwards. With costs dropping and processing power soaring, rudimentary algorithms and neural networks were developed that finally allowed AI to live up to early expectations.

Fueling Change: The Power of AI and Market Data in Transforming … – J.D. Power

Fueling Change: The Power of AI and Market Data in Transforming ….

Posted: Thu, 08 Jun 2023 17:01:20 GMT [source]

Here are just a few examples of where image recognition is likely to change the way we work and play. Social media has rapidly grown to become an integral part of any business’s brand. Many of these problems can be directly addressed using image recognition.

ai based image recognition

Image recognition software enables applications to use deep learning algorithms in order to recognize and understand images or videos with artificial intelligence. Compare the best Image Recognition software currently available using the table below. While human beings process images and classify the objects inside images quite easily, the same is impossible for a machine unless it has been specifically trained to do so. The result of image recognition is to accurately identify and classify detected objects into various predetermined categories with the help of deep learning technology. The corresponding smaller sections are normalized, and an activation function is applied to them.

  • Before starting with this blog, first have a basic introduction to CNN to brush up on your skills.
  • Choosing the right type and architecture of a neural network plays an essential part in creating an efficient AI-based image processing solution.
  • Now, we have our AI that can run analyses on images, and we have a picture of a pen.
  • As self-driving cars become more prevalent, AI-based image recognition will be essential in ensuring their safe and efficient operation.
  • The technique you use depends on the application but, in general, the more complex the problem, the more likely you will want to explore deep learning techniques.
  • Neocognitron can thus be labelled as the first neural network to earn the label ”deep” and is rightly seen as the ancestor of today’s convolutional networks.

What AI algorithm for face recognition?

Convolutional neural networks are one of the most widely used algorithms for facial recognition (CNNs). These are a particular class of neural network that excel at image recognition tasks. CNNs are made up of many layers of artificial neurons that have been taught to recognise aspects in a picture.